The Market at Locale in Boise Returns This June
Looking for things to do in Boise this summer? The Market at Locale Boise is back for 2026, bringing together local shopping, food trucks, live music, and community fun for an unforgettable evening in the Treasure Valley.
Join us on Friday, June 12th from 4–7 PM at Locale Community, 7154 W Sugarwood St, Boise, ID for a family-friendly market featuring Boise’s favorite local vendors, delicious bites, entertainment, and a first look at one of Boise’s most unique communities.
